The 5 Tools Actually Moving the Needle Right Now

1. Magnifi (The Conversational Broker):

Think of this as your personal research assistant. Instead of digging through SEC filings, you just ask, “Where are the low-volatility tech stocks?” and it handles the execution across your accounts.

2. Intuit Assist (The Tax Weapon)

This is the gold standard for anyone self-employed. It scans your statements and automatically flags deductions. It’s a perfect companion if you’re already digging into our guide on Tax Deductions for Freelancers, ensuring you never leave money on the table.

3. Cleo (The Reality Check)

If you have a problem with impulse spending, Cleo’s “Roast Mode” is the tough love you need. It’s behavioral finance with a personality, designed to keep your savings goals on track without being boring.

    4. PortfolioPilot (The High-Net-Worth Edge)

    This tool treats your retail account like an institutional fund. It tracks everything from your house value to your crypto. If you’re heavy into digital assets, just make sure you’re syncing this with a solid Crypto Tax Calculator 2026 to avoid any headaches with the IRS.

    5. Origin (The Total Dashboard)

    This is for the person who wants it all in one place—budgeting, estate planning, and even insurance. It’s the ultimate “set it and forget it” wealth platform.
